Con Edison, Inc. and its subsidiaries form one of the nation’s largest energy companies, supplying electricity, natural gas and steam to approximately 10 million people in New York City and the suburbs north of the city. Con Edison’s energy-delivery grid is among the safest and most reliable in the country. The company is investing to prepare for the impacts of climate change and an energy system centered around renewables. Through its Clean Energy Commitment, Con Edison has promised to offer 100% clean electricity by 2040, accelerate the reduction of fossil fuel used for heating, and dramatically expand its investments in energy efficiency. Outside of New York, the company’s Clean Energy Businesses constitute the second largest generator of solar energy in North America, with large-scale renewable projects in 20 states. Con Edison is the Transport Program Partner for Climate Week NYC, highlighting its efforts to prepare the city for an automotive future dominated by electric vehicles. Through its PowerReady program, Con Edison will incentivize the development of 21,000 Level 2 plugs and 525 fast chargers by 2025. |
